Does sweat change its smell if you eat to much of one thing?

I am just getting over a nasty nasty nasty flu and cold, I had a lot of cough drops to help soothe my throat and cough.


I have noticed that my sweat smells differently now, smells like medicine or something. Could this be from all the cough drops?
Does sweat change its smell if you eat to much of one thing?
Probably. Stuff like onions %26amp; garlic, asparagus, fish, curry, and other strongly-odored food will make your sweat and pee smell like those products as well.
